Product Description P/N: 193X802DAG01 DESCRIPTION / SPECIFICATIONS Description The 193X802DAG01 is a Coordination Signal Amplifier Torque Limit Card from GE, engineered to regulate and amplify torque limit signals within control systems. It ensures precise torque control by enhancing signal accuracy and reliability, crucial for maintaining optimal performance and safety in industrial machinery. 

This card supports effective torque management and system stability. Technical Specifications Condition New / Never Used Surplus Brand General Electric Category PLCs/Machine Control Part Number 193X802DAG01 Subcategory PC Board PLC/Add-On Board Type Signal Amplifier Card Function Amplifies coordination signals and manages torque limit in industrial systems Operating Temperature 0掳C to +60掳C Storage Temperature -20掳C to +70掳C Humidity Range 5% to 95% non-condensing Information About 193X802DAG01

Manufacturer information General Electric (GE) is a multinational conglomerate founded in 1892, based in the United States. It operates in various industries, including aviation, healthcare, renewable energy, and power. GE is known for its innovations in technology, manufacturing, and infrastructure solutions.
